Project Title Indian River Shoreline Stabilization
Total Estimated Cost $ 32 000
Brief Description of Project: The Indian River Shoreline Stabilization Project will create
an artificial reef using oyster modules to prevent sand erosion and stimulate sea grass growth in a
2,400-square-foot restoration area on the western shore of the Indian River near the Fort Pierce
Inlet. The near-shore project will include the installation of 24 reefs measuring 100 square feet
by 3 feet high within intertidal waters where shoaling persists.
Successful creation of oyster habitat and recruitment of sea grass could result in the
installation of similar artificial reefs in up to 10 other locations in the Indian River along the
Intracoastal Waterway where erosion is a recurring issue.
AND, Florida Inland Navigation District financial assistance is required for the program
mentioned above,
NOW THEREFORE, be it resolved by the _St. Lucie County Board of Countv
Commissioners that the project described above be authorized,
AND, be it further resolved that said St. Lucie County Board of Countv Commissioners
make application to the Florida Inland Navigation District in the amount of 50 % of the
actual cost of the project in behalf of said St. Lucie Countv Board of County Commissioners.
AND, be it further resolved by the St. Lucie County Board of County Commissioners
that it certifies to the following:
1. That it will accept the terms and conditions set forth in FIND Rule 66B-2
F.A.C. and which will be a part of the Project Agreement for any assistance awarded under
the attached proposal.
2. That it is in complete accord with the attached proposal and that it will carry out
the Program in the manner described in the proposal and any plans and specifications attached
thereto unless prior approval for any change has been received from the District.

3. That it has the ability and intention to finance its share of the cost of the project
and that the project will be operated and maintained at the expense of said St. Lucie Countv
Board of County Commissioners for public use.
4. That it will not discriminate against any person on the basis of race, color or
national origin in the use of any property or facility acquired or developed pursuant to this
proposal, and shall comply with the terms and intent of the Title VI of the Civil Rights Act of
1964, P. L. 88-352 (1964) and design and construct all facilities to comply fully with statutes
relating to accessibility by handicapped persons as well as other federal, state and local
laws, rules and requirements.
5. That it will maintain adequate financial records on the proposed project to
substantiate claims for reimbursement.
6. That it will make available to FIND if requested, a post-audit of expenses
incurred on the project prior to, or in conjunction with, request for the final 10% of the
funding agreed to by FIND.
